Job summary
A rare and exciting opportunity has arisen for a motivated and forward-thinking Registered Dental Nurse to join The Shrewsbury and Telford Hospital NHS Trust.

Working within a friendly and supportive multidisciplinary team, the successful candidate will work alongside Orthodontic Consultants, Maxillofacial Consultants, Dental Core Trainees (DCTs), Orthodontic Therapists and Hygienists, providing high-quality clinical support and contributing to excellent patient care.

The successful applicant must hold a recognised Dental Nursing qualification and be registered with the General Dental Council (GDC). Applicants should also have experience working within a dental setting and demonstrate excellent communication, organisational and teamwork skills.

This is an excellent opportunity for a dedicated Dental Nurse looking to develop their skills and experience within a specialist hospital environment.

Please note, this vacancy does NOT meet the eligibility requirements for Sponsorship and we will not be able to offer sponsorship for this role

Main duties of the job

  • This role supports dental and medical staff in outpatient clinics at two hospitals.
  • You will help with dental surgeries, orthodontic treatments, and other specialist procedures.
  • You'll prepare equipment, keep records, and make sure clinics run smoothly.
  • You'll work closely with patients, including those who may be nervous or need extra support.
  • You'll follow safety rules and help keep the clinic clean and organised.
  • You'll also help train new staff and take part in learning and development activities.

Person Specification
Qualifications
Essential

  • Certificate in Dental Nursing
  • Registered with the General Dental Council
  • Educated to GCSE in English and Maths (or equivalent)


Experience and knowledge
Essential

  • Experience of working in a dental setting


Desirable

  • Experience of fixed appliance therapy
  • Experience in Oral Surgery procedures
  • Experience in Dental radiography
  • Knowledge of maxillofacial procedures
  • Knowledge of orthodontic procedures
